document.write( "Question 80345: Is there a way to find the height of an object using its shadow? \n" ); document.write( "
Algebra.Com's Answer #57636 by Edwin McCravy(20060)![]() ![]() You can put this solution on YOUR website! \r\n" ); document.write( "is there a way to find the height of an object using its shadow\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"Yes. Suppose you want to know the height of a flagpole.\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"1. Measure the flagpole's shadow.\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"2. Get a straight stick.\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"3. Measure the stick\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"3. Hold the stick upright.\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"4. Measure the stick's shadows.\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"5. Make the equation:\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( " LENGTH OF STICK HEIGHT OF FLAGPOLE\r\n" ); document.write( " -------------------------- = ------------------------------\r\n" ); document.write( " LENGTH OF STICK'S SHADOW LENGTH OF FLAGPOLE'S SHADOW\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"7. Substitute the unknown x for the HEIGHT OF FLAGPOLE.\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"8. Substitute the three measurements from steps 1, 3, and 4.\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"9. Solve the resulting equation for x.\r\n" ); document.write( "\r\n" ); document.write( "Edwin\n" ); document.write( " |
